Jazz Revelation Japan: Shinya Fukumori

Drummer, composer, and producer Shinya Fukumori introduces some of the best jazz happening today in Japan and Asia, and anything related. (As an artist and a producer) Fukumori has long been emphasising the value of developing sound that is truly unique to Asian culture, perhaps best epitomised in a Japanese idiom “Ryusui Fufu,” which can be interpreted as “flowing water never goes stale.” Here at Jazz Revelation Japan, Fukumori will, not only share some of his works and of his close allies, but also unearth new sounds and talents that embrace such aesthetic. About Shinya Fukumori Shinya Fukumori was born on January 5th, 1984 in Osaka, Japan. Known for his melodic and rhythmic approach with a wide range of dynamics to drum-set playing. His unique and sensitive cymbal-work creates a very distinctive sound. In 2013, he relocates to Munich, Germany and releases his debut album “For 2 Akis” from ECM Records with his trio in 2018. In 2020, he launches his own music label ‘nagalu’ and releases its first full album “Another Story”. A year later in 2021, Fukumori creates another label ’S/N Alliance’ to create opportunities and expand possibilities for up-and-coming artists not just in Japan, but from all around the world. Fukumori visualizes himself working as a producer as well, building a bridge between where his identity lies and where his music’s universality flourishes.
